### What Are Sankey Charts?

Sankey diagrams are graphical representations used to illustrate flows in system such as material or energy. They were first used in the 19th century to depict the flow of steam. These diagrams are characterized by rectangular segments on the nodes, and rectangles that define pathways through the diagram that join together at angles to show the flow.

Sankey diagrams have a few core features:

– **Nodes**: Represent distinct points in the system, often categories or groups.
– **Flow**: Represents the quantity from one node to another, typically with width proportional to the amount of flow.
– **Arrows**: Directional lines that connect the nodes, indicating the flow movement.

### Key Benefits of Sankey Charts

1. **Visualization of Flows**: Sankey charts excel at showing the quantity of flows between categories, making it easier to comprehend complex datasets.
2. **Comparison**: They allow for easy comparison between different categories, showing not just flows but the magnitude of those flows.
3. **Interactivity**: With modern software tools, users can interact with Sankey diagrams, making them a versatile element in presentation tools.
4. **Clarity**: With the appropriate layout and design, complex data relationships can become transparent and comprehensible at a glance.

### How to Create a Sankey Chart

Creating a Sankey diagram involves several key steps:

1. **Data Preparation**: Ensure your data is structured in a format that can be easily parsed by your chosen tool. Typically, this involves defining categories for nodes, the flows between these categories, and the magnitude of those flows.
2. **Choosing a Tool**: Depending on your needs and familiarity with the tools available, there are numerous software options for creating Sankey diagrams. Popular choices include Microsoft Power BI, Tableau, R, Python libraries like Plotly and Bokeh, and dedicated web-based tools like Vizzlo and DrawSankey.
3. **Designing Your Chart**:
– **Layout**: Arrange your nodes and flows. For complex systems, radial or circular layouts can be more visually appealing.
– **Colors and Legends**: Select colors to visually distinguish different flows and provide a legend if necessary.
– **Widths**: Ensure the widths of your flows are proportional to the magnitude of the data they represent.
4. **Enhancing Readability**: Use tooltips, labels, and clear, well-organized design elements to improve the clarity of the chart.
5. **Review and Finalize**: Always review the final chart for any minor adjustments needed to improve aesthetics and maintain clarity.

### Best Practices for Mastering Sankey Charts

– **Focus on Clarity**: Prioritize making complex data relationships clear to your audience. This might mean experimenting with different layouts or chart types.
– **Maintain Simplicity**: Avoid overloading the chart with too much data. Too many categories or flows can make the chart overly complex and difficult to understand.
– **Use Consistent Colors**: This helps in maintaining the integrity of the data and makes comparison between different flows easier.
– **Analyze Feedback**: After creating your charts, seek feedback to see if they are effectively conveying the intended message. Adjustments might be needed based on user comprehension and reaction.
